Transaction a1576c94caa93017458003031600cb3dec296ca4b1231820afab14421f1d0af0

1 Input
2 Outputs
  • a1576c94caa93017458003031600cb3dec296ca4b1231820afab14421f1d0af0:0
  • value  83994
    address  1Hm8sM5wCSJKAPREjVUXHffQZyCPxiSSrs
  • a1576c94caa93017458003031600cb3dec296ca4b1231820afab14421f1d0af0:1
  • value  946623
    address  3LUdru8aBE9YjjE7VihBXnNU5baPH9nz8k